If their proliferation is not exceptional, the phenomenon would be earlier than in previous years. The water temperature rose faster, which promoted the development of plankton that jellyfish feed on, stimulating their growth and reproduction.

The most widespread species currently on the Atlantic coast is the "compass jellyfish" - whose stinging power is very strong. It is up to you to be careful not to be in their way, says an aquariology specialist who advises avoiding them in water and on the sand.
